def get_function_target_subscription_ids(self): self._initialize_session() if constants.ENV_FUNCTION_MANAGEMENT_GROUP_NAME in os.environ: return ManagedGroupHelper.get_subscriptions_list( os.environ[constants.ENV_FUNCTION_MANAGEMENT_GROUP_NAME], self.get_credentials()) return [os.environ.get(constants.ENV_FUNCTION_SUB_ID, self.subscription_id)]
def get_function_target_subscription_ids(self): self._initialize_session() if constants.ENV_FUNCTION_MANAGED_GROUP_NAME in os.environ: return ManagedGroupHelper.get_subscriptions_list( os.environ[constants.ENV_FUNCTION_MANAGED_GROUP_NAME], self.get_credentials()) return [os.environ.get(constants.ENV_FUNCTION_SUB_ID, self.subscription_id)]
def test_managed_group_helper(self, _1): sub_ids = ManagedGroupHelper.get_subscriptions_list('test-group', "") self.assertEqual(sub_ids, [DEFAULT_SUBSCRIPTION_ID, GUID])